A listeria episode connected to entire peaches, nectarines and plums has brought about 10 hospitalizations and one passing, the Places for Infectious prevention and Counteraction said Monday.

The California-put together HMC Homesteads with respect to Friday willfully reviewed the organic product sold between May 1 and November 15, 2022, and between May 1 and November 15, 2023.

The review does exclude peaches, plums, and nectarines at present being sold in stores.

The impacted natural product was sold in two-pound packs marked “HMC Homesteads” or “Mark Ranches” or as individual natural product with a sticker perusing “USA-E-U.” Pictures of the reviewed natural product can be seen here.

Listeria side effects incorporate muscle throbs, fever and sluggishness and may start in the span of about fourteen days subsequent to eating the polluted food, the CDC said. They may likewise happen as soon as that very day or as late as 10 weeks after openness. It is particularly destructive to individuals who are pregnant, 65 or more established, or have a debilitated safe framework.

Buyers who bought the natural product are told to quickly toss it out or return it to the store. The CDC said fridges and surfaces where the reviewed natural product contacted ought to be entirely cleaned.
Eleven individuals became wiped out in states including California, Colorado, Florida, Illinois, Kansas, Michigan and Ohio, as per the CDC. One of those individuals was a pregnant lady who went into preterm work. Ten individuals were hospitalized and one individual in California kicked the bucket.

A representative for HMC Homesteads said their hearts go out to each and every individual who was impacted.

“There isn’t anything more critical to us than giving protected, top notch natural product to buyers. We never believe that anybody should turn out to be sick from eating new organic product,” Amy Philpott, an organization representative, said. “The organization is working enthusiastically with the FDA to examine how the pollution occurred.”

The CDC said the genuine number of debilitated individuals could be higher, and the episode could be in different states.

“This is on the grounds that certain individuals recuperate without clinical consideration and are not tried for Listeria,” the CDC said. “Moreover, ongoing diseases may not as yet be accounted for as it normally requires 3 to about a month to decide whether a debilitated individual is essential for a flare-up.”
